In android Gear Vr, is it possible to launch an application in normal/phone mode, and then have it transition to Unity/VR when the user clicks the option?
In android Gear Vr, is it possible to launch an application in normal/phone mode, and then have it transition to Unity/VR when the user clicks a button to go into VR?
So far the app either launches completely in VR with "vr_only" as an option, or launches normally and goes to Oculus Home when we try "vr_both" or "vr_dual".
Is such a thing possible, or will we have to make two separate apps?
Answer by Verdemis · Aug 16, 2016 at 08:10 PM
I'm only unsing google vr, but maybe my solution could work for you too. I'm guessing gear vr works similar.
This is how I did this. In the main menu of my game I made a button "switch to vr mode". When the player clicks this option I reload the current scene and instantiate the gvrViewer Prefab (which makes the camera a stereo cam and activates headtracking) and I set my boolean vrMode variable in my gamemanager object to true. When the player starts the game and vrMode is true, I instantiate the gvrViewer and when it's false I do not.
Unfortunately that doesn't work. We tried that and when we put on the Gear it will simply launch Oculus Home ins$$anonymous$$d of going to VR mode. :(
